From March 22nd to the 26th, our coaches Dave, Francis, James, and Tim visited Liverpool headquarters for the annual International Academy Coaches Convention with more than 30 senior coaches worldwide. On this trip, they learned from many guest speakers and saw the Liverpool grounds. They toured the Anfield Stadium, The Academy, and the AXA Training Center. As well as visited Goodison Park to watch Everton Women vs. LFC Women and attended the LFC Legends vs. Celtic Legends game at Anfield Stadium.
Day 1
Arriving at Anfield Stadium, all coaches were welcomed with food and a speech. From then, the convention officially started. Throughout the day, the coaches attended multiple sessions—delivered by LFC IA Ambassador Ian Rush and LFC Academy coaches—where they learned about coaching culture and participated in group activities. At the end of the day, the coaches toured Anfield Stadium and enjoyed a social event in the stadium lounge.

Day 2
On Day 2, the coaches traveled to The Academy, participated in an on-pitch session delivery, attended more guest speaker presentations—delivered by John Barnes and LFC Academy Coaches—and observed an LFC Academy training.

Day 3
At The Academy, coaches toured the AXA Training Center, delivered their Group Task Session, which they had been working on during day 2, and then wrapped up the convention. They also attended the Everton Women vs. LFC Women game at Goodison Park.
